Task #2: Watch video #2 on soccer rules/laws of the game and then answer these questions:
1). If the ball touches your elbow during a game, is that considered a hand ball?
yes
2). How many minutes is a full soccer game, and how long is each half? (note – in high school soccer,
each half will be 5 minutes less than a normal game length)
80 minutes each half is 40 minutes
3). Where on the field can a goalie use their hands?
Inside the penalty area
4). What is the first action of game called/you start the game with a kickoff ? When else does this occur?
Kickoffs also happen after the other team scores .
5). If the ball is mostly outside of the field lines (endline or sideline), but still touching the line a little bit,
is the ball considered in or out?
In
6). Do your best to explain what the offsides rule is.
The receiving player or attacking player can’t be behind the last defender on the opposing team.
7). Can you be offsides on a throw in?
No
8). When is a free-kick awarded?
When there is a foul or hand ball
9). Explain the difference between a direct and indirect kick.
A direct kick is aimed at the goal and doesn’t have to touch a player but an indirect kick has to touch a
player to count.
10). What happens if a foul occurs inside of the penalty box?
Penalty kick
11). Fill in the blank: A throw in occurs when the ball goes over the side line.
12). True or False: one foot can come off the ground during a throw in.
False
13). Use the words “defending” and “attacking” to fill in the blanks appropriately:
For a corner kick to occur, the defending team kicked the ball over the end line. For a
goal kick to occur, the attacking team kicked the ball over the end line.
